ESPN is kicking off the College Basketball season with its first annual college hoops tip-off marathon starting at midnight on Tuesday, November 18.  Included in this slate of 14 college basketball games is a great Philadelphia city rivalry between the Drexel Dragons and the Penn Quakers.  The game is being played at 10:00 a.m. Eastern time and will be played at the Daskalakis Athletic Center on Drexel's campus.

In Division I basketball, there are no two programs closer geographically to each other than Drexel and Penn.  Down in Center City Philadelphia, Drexel and Penn's campus are separated by one street and you can often see Penn students on Drexel's campus and vice-versa.

Drexel and Penn play each other every year and the game is usually held at the Palestra on Penn's campus, which is the oldest college basketball venue in the entire country.  But this year, Drexel gets to play the host for the first time in a long time and the DAC will be rocking on Tuesday morning.

Normally competitive men's basketball programs, both Drexel and Penn had down years in 2007-2008.  The Dragons finished with an overall record of 12-20, including 5-13 in the Colonial Athletic Association, and Penn finished with a solid Ivy League mark of 8-6, but had a sub-par overall record of 13-18.

This college hoops marathon courtesy of ESPN starts off with a match up between the Massachusetts Minutemen and last year's National runner-up, the Memphis Tigers.
